Understanding Player Statistics
Player statistics provide valuable insights into an individual athlete’s performance. When analyzing player statistics, it’s essential to look beyond the basic numbers such as points scored or goals scored. Instead, focus on more advanced metrics such as shooting percentage, assists, rebounds, and other relevant indicators of a player’s overall contribution to the team’s performance. By taking a deep dive into these statistics, you can better understand a player’s strengths, weaknesses, and overall impact on the game.
Team Performance Metrics
In addition to analyzing individual player statistics, it’s equally important to consider team performance metrics. Team statistics such as offensive and defensive efficiency, turnover rates, and rebounding margins can provide valuable insights into a team’s overall performance. By examining these metrics, you can gain a better understanding of a team’s playing style, strengths, and potential areas for improvement. This comprehensive approach to data analysis can help you make more accurate predictions about how a team is likely to perform in upcoming games.
Utilizing Historical Data
Another important aspect of data analysis in sports predictions is the use of historical data. By examining past performance data for both players and teams, you can identify long-term trends and patterns that can help inform your predictions. Historical data can provide valuable context for understanding how certain players and teams have performed in similar situations in the past, which can be incredibly valuable when trying to predict future outcomes.
